1. Use Indexes Wisely
Indexes speed up data retrieval but can slow down write operations. Proper indexing is essential for optimizing SELECT queries.
When to Use Indexes:
Columns frequently used in
WHEREclauses.Columns used in
JOINoperations.Columns used for sorting (
ORDER BY).
Example: Creating an Index
sql
Copy
Download
CREATE INDEX idx_customer_name ON customers(name);
When to Avoid Indexes:
On small tables (fewer than 1000 rows).
On columns with low cardinality (e.g.,
genderwith only 'M'/'F' values).
2. Optimize SELECT Queries
Avoid using SELECT * as it retrieves unnecessary columns, increasing I/O and memory usage.
Bad Practice:
sql
Copy
Download
SELECT * FROM orders;
Optimized Query:
sql
Copy
Download
SELECT order_id, customer_id, order_date FROM orders;
3. Use Joins Efficiently
Improper joins can lead to performance bottlenecks.
Prefer INNER JOIN Over WHERE for Clarity & Performance
sql
Copy
Download
-- Less efficient
SELECT o.order_id, c.name
FROM orders o, customers c
WHERE o.customer_id = c.customer_id;
-- Better
SELECT o.order_id, c.name
FROM orders o
INNER JOIN customers c ON o.customer_id = c.customer_id;
Avoid CROSS JOIN Unless Necessary
A CROSS JOIN produces a Cartesian product, which can be extremely slow on large tables.
4. Limit Results with LIMIT or TOP
Fetching only necessary rows reduces query execution time.
MySQL/PostgreSQL:
sql
Copy
Download
SELECT * FROM products LIMIT 10;
SQL Server:
sql
Copy
Download
SELECT TOP 10 * FROM products;
5. Avoid Subqueries When Possible
Subqueries can be inefficient. Use JOIN instead where applicable.
Inefficient Subquery:
sql
Copy
Download
SELECT name FROM customers
WHERE customer_id IN (SELECT customer_id FROM orders WHERE status = 'shipped');
Optimized with JOIN:
sql
Copy
Download
SELECT DISTINCT c.name
FROM customers c
JOIN orders o ON c.customer_id = o.customer_id
WHERE o.status = 'shipped';
6. Use EXPLAIN to Analyze Query Performance
Most databases provide an EXPLAIN command to analyze query execution plans.
Example in MySQL:
sql
Copy
Download
EXPLAIN SELECT * FROM orders WHERE customer_id = 100;
This reveals:
Whether indexes are used.
The order of table scans.
Estimated rows processed.
7. Avoid LIKE with Leading Wildcards
Queries with LIKE '%keyword%' cannot use indexes efficiently.
Inefficient:
sql
Copy
Download
SELECT * FROM products WHERE name LIKE '%shirt%';
Better (if possible):
sql
Copy
Download
SELECT * FROM products WHERE name LIKE 'shirt%';
8. Use Stored Procedures for Complex Queries
Stored procedures reduce network overhead and improve performance by pre-compiling SQL logic.
Example:
sql
Copy
Download
CREATE PROCEDURE GetRecentOrders(IN days INT)
BEGIN
SELECT * FROM orders
WHERE order_date >= NOW() - INTERVAL days DAY;
END;
Call it with:
sql
Copy
Download
CALL GetRecentOrders(7);
9. Normalize (and Sometimes Denormalize) Your Database
Normalization Benefits:
Reduces data redundancy.
Improves data integrity.
When to Denormalize:
For read-heavy applications where joins are expensive.
In reporting databases where speed is critical.
